Overview

Kelso State School is a government primary school in Kelso, Queensland, serving Prep-6. The school has 303 enrolled students. Its ICSEA value is 828 (well below average). The student-to-teacher ratio is 12.4:1. The school is located in a SEIFA IRSD decile 1 area.

Source: ACARA School Profile 2025 (2025)
